Identifier RHMA
Protein name RecName: Full=2-keto-3-deoxy-L-rhamnonate aldolase;
                 Short=KDR aldolase;
                 EC=4.1.2.53;
AltName: Full=2-dehydro-3-deoxyrhamnonate aldolase;
Gene name Name=rhmA;

Comments [?]

FUNCTIONCatalyzes the reversible retro-aldol cleavage of 2-keto-3- deoxy-L-rhamnonate (KDR) to pyruvate and lactaldehyde.
CATALYTIC ACTIVITY Reaction=2-dehydro-3-deoxy-L-rhamnonate = (S)-lactaldehyde + pyruvate; Xref=Rhea:RHEA:25784, ChEBI:CHEBI:15361, ChEBI:CHEBI:18041, ChEBI:CHEBI:58371; EC=4.1.2.53;
case <FTGroup:1>
COFACTOR Name=Mg(2+); Xref=ChEBI:CHEBI:18420; Note=Binds 1 Mg(2+) ion per subunit.;
end case
SUBUNITHomohexamer.
SIMILARITYBelongs to the HpcH/HpaI aldolase family. KDR aldolase subfamily.
